ImageCapOnWeb控件使用与功能详解

3星 · 超过75%的资源 需积分: 10 9 下载量 8 浏览量 更新于2024-09-19 收藏 246KB PDF 举报
"ImageCapOnWeb控件是一个用于Web编程的摄像头视频采集工具,它基于DirectX技术,兼容各种USB摄像头,并能在多种服务器端技术环境下运行,如asp、jsp、php和asp.net。控件提供了图像采集、裁剪、旋转和本地保存等功能,简化了在Web应用中集成摄像头功能的流程。" 本文档详细介绍了ImageCapOnWeb控件的使用,包括其主要功能、集成方法、操作方法以及常见问题的解决方案。 (一) 控件总体功能说明 ImageCapOnWeb控件的核心功能是帮助开发者实现在Web应用程序中轻松获取和处理摄像头的视频流。它支持所有类型的USB摄像头,无论是外接还是内置,且与多种服务器端编程语言兼容。此外,控件还具备图像裁剪、旋转和本地存储功能,使得用户能够根据需要对捕获的图像进行编辑。 (二) 控件集成使用说明 集成此控件到Web项目中,首先需要将ImageCapOnWeb.cab文件复制到项目目录,并在需要使用摄像头功能的HTML页面中,通过`<object>`标签引用该控件。引用时需要指定`classid`、`codebase`、`width`和`height`等属性,同时可以设置其他参数,如`Visible`和`AutoScroll`,来控制控件的可见性和自动滚动行为。 (三) 控件方法说明 1. 启动视频捕捉:调用控件的方法启动摄像头,开始视频流的捕捉。 2. 抓拍摄像头视频画面:在视频流中选取某一帧并进行抓取,生成静态图像。 3. 读取抓拍的画面结果数据:提供两种格式读取抓拍图像数据,即jpg和bmp,便于后续处理或上传。 - 按照jpg格式读取结果数据:适合网络传输,文件较小。 - 按照bmp格式读取结果数据:保留更多细节,但文件较大。 (四) 控件属性及方法表格 文档中可能包含了控件的所有属性和方法的详细列表,以便开发者了解和调用,但由于这部分内容未提供,此处无法给出具体详情。 (五) 常见问题 1. 控件升级:提供了控件升级到新版本的步骤和注意事项。 2. 验证注册:解释了如何确认控件是否已成功注册为正式版。 3. 高清摄像头拍照失败:针对高清摄像头拍照上传失败的问题,给出了可能的原因和解决策略。 4. 浏览器假死:提供了处理因使用控件导致浏览器假死情况的建议。 总结,ImageCapOnWeb控件为Web开发者提供了一套便捷的摄像头交互解决方案,涵盖了从视频捕获到图像处理的多个环节,同时提供了丰富的技术支持以解决实际开发中的问题。